
如何验证java连接数据库
用户关注问题
如何确认Java程序成功连接数据库?
我写了Java代码连接数据库,但不确定连接是否成功,有什么方法可以验证?
通过捕获异常和执行简单查询确认连接
可以尝试执行一个简单的SQL查询语句,比如SELECT 1,若能成功执行且无异常抛出,则说明Java程序已成功连接到数据库。同时,可以通过捕获SQLException异常来判断是否连接失败。还可以打印连接对象的状态信息,辅助判断连接情况。
Java连接数据库时需注意哪些配置文件或参数?
在使用Java连接数据库之前,哪些信息必须正确配置,避免连接失败?
数据库URL、用户名、密码和驱动程序配置
需要确保数据库的URL格式正确,数据库服务器地址、端口号和数据库名称都准确无误。用户名和密码必须与数据库的账户信息匹配,且驱动程序(比如MySQL的JDBC驱动)需要正确导入项目中。任何配置错误都会导致连接失败。
有没有工具或方法可以帮助测试Java数据库连接?
除了代码验证外,有哪些辅助工具或技巧可以用来测试Java程序连接数据库的情况?
使用数据库客户端和日志输出辅助测试
可以先使用数据库客户端工具(如MySQL Workbench、DBeaver)连接数据库,确认数据库本身运行正常。Java程序中可以开启日志功能,输出连接状态和SQL执行情况,辅助排查问题。此外,也能利用单元测试框架编写测试用例专门验证数据库连接代码。